Storing measured values in the pallet preset
table
You use this function for determining pallet datums. This
function must be enabled by your machine tool builder.
In order to store a measured value in the pallet preset
table, you must activate a zero preset before probing. A
zero preset consists of the entry 0 in all axes of the preset
table!
U
Select any probe function
U
Enter the desired coordinates of the datum in the appropriate input
boxes (depends on the touch probe cycle being run)
U
Enter the preset number in the Number in table: input box
U
Press the ENTER IN PALLET PRES. TAB. soft key. The TNC saves
the datum in the preset table under the number entered
